#646913 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#646913 is composed of 39.2% red, 41.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 63.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 24.3%. #646913 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8d226 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#646913 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#646913 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#646913 has RGB values of R:100, G:105,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6580499.

Shades and Tints of #646913
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#646913
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3e3e is the less saturated color, while #717705 is the most saturated one.
